What is MMCCCLX in Roman Numerals?

What is the value of MMCCCLX in Roman numerals?

The Roman numeral MMCCCLX is equivalent to 2360 in Arabic numerals.

Therefore, if you want to write the digit 2360 using Roman symbols, you must use the letter combination MMCCCLX. This letter combination is equivalent in Roman writing to the Arabic numeral Two thousand three hundred sixty.

MMCCCLX = 2360

How should the Roman numeral MMCCCLX be read?

It should be noted that Roman letters symbolizing numbers should be read and written from left to right and in the order from largest to smallest.

If the Roman numeral MMCCCLX is found in a text, it should be read as a natural number, that is, in this case it should be read as "Two thousand three hundred sixty".
